This afternoon, we tracked a new mission of a US Army Bombardier ARTEMIS (reg. N488CR – c/s BRIO68) over Romania and western Bulgaria.
The mission appears to follow the pattern of those tracked a few weeks ago, which were focused on Serbia.
The American aircraft, in fact, orbited east of the Serbian border for over 8 hours, carrying out a typical SIGINT mission.
The ARTEMIS (Airborne Reconnaissance and Targeting Multi-Mission Intelligence System) is a Bombardier Challenger 650 business jet modified for advanced intelligence, surveillance, and reconnaissance (ISR) missions. Developed for the U.S. Army, it is equipped with SIGINT (signals intelligence) and ELINT (electronic intelligence) sensors, allowing it to intercept and analyze enemy communications and radar emissions.
With its long endurance and high-altitude capabilities, the ARTEMIS plays a crucial role in monitoring military activities, particularly in strategic regions such as Eastern Europe.
